A refined take on the simple wedding veil.

The Classic Tulle Veil – Slim Width is designed for brides who want nothing unnecessary—only proportion, movement, and light. Cut from soft bridal tulle and left with a clean, raw edge, it falls in a narrow, uninterrupted line from crown to hem.

No trim. No embellishment. Nothing to distract from the silhouette.

What sets this veil apart is its width.

The slim 60” cut creates a more elongated, controlled drape—lighter, narrower, and intentionally restrained. It sits closer to the body and moves with ease, offering a more modern alternative to traditional full-width veils.

The result is a veil that feels considered, not minimal for the sake of simplicity.

Construction

Each veil is cut from sheer bridal tulle and hand gathered onto a discreet metal comb. The edge is left completely raw, with no stitching or finishing, allowing the fabric to fall naturally and without weight.

Lightweight, fluid, and transparent, it’s designed to enhance the gown rather than compete with it.

Made to order in Los Angeles.

Length options

Available in multiple lengths to suit your look:

  • Fingertip (approx. 40”) – soft, effortless, and modern
  • Waltz (approx 50") - slightly extended, graceful
  • Chapel (approx. 120") – subtle length with gentle movement behind the gown
  • Cathedral  (approx 150")– extended length for a more formal, elongated silhouette

Slim vs Full Width

The Slim Width (60”) is designed for a clean, minimal silhouette with very little volume.

For a fuller, more traditional look with added width and presence, explore the Full Width version of this veil.

Details

  • Soft sheer bridal tulle
  • Slim 60” width
  • Raw cut edge (no trim or stitching)
  • Single layer
  • Hand gathered onto metal comb
  • Lightweight and fluid drape
  • Made to order in Los Angeles. Never mass produced.
